How to Build Muscle Safely

Building muscle is a common goal for many people, whether it’s to improve strength, boost athletic performance, or simply look and feel better. Whatever your reason may be, it’s important to approach muscle growth in a safe and effective manner to avoid potential health risks and injuries. So, how can you build muscle safely and optimally?

Firstly, understand that muscle growth doesn’t happen overnight. It’s a gradual process that requires dedication and a well-rounded approach. A balanced diet rich in protein, carbohydrates, and healthy fats is essential. Ensure your protein intake is adequate as it provides the amino acids required for muscle repair and growth. Include a variety of protein sources such as lean meats, fish, eggs, dairy, and plant-based proteins like quinoa and beans.

Carbohydrates are also key, offering the body its main source of energy. Opt for complex carbs such as whole grains, fruits, and vegetables, which provide sustained energy and essential nutrients. Healthy fats, found in foods like avocado, nuts, and olive oil, are necessary for overall health and help support hormone production, which is vital for muscle growth.

Resistance training is the cornerstone of muscle building. Incorporate a variety of exercises that target different muscle groups, such as squats, deadlifts, bench presses, and rows. Ensure you’re using proper form to avoid injury and maximize the effectiveness of each exercise. Start with lighter weights and gradually increase the load as you progress, always listening to your body and not pushing beyond your limits.

Give your muscles time to rest and recover between workouts. This is when muscle growth and repair occur, so ensure you’re getting sufficient sleep each night (7-9 hours is recommended). Additionally, take rest days between training sessions to give your body a chance to rejuvenate.
